Title: Innovator Spotlight: Michael R. Fannon
Introduction
Michael R. Fannon is a distinguished inventor based in Silver Spring, Maryland, who has made significant contributions to the field of genomics. With a total of nine patents to his name, his work focuses on the understanding and utilization of genetic sequences, which has profound implications for research and application in biotechnology.
Latest Patents
Among his recent innovations, Michael R. Fannon has developed several noteworthy patents. One key invention provides polynucleotide sequences of the genome, along with polypeptide sequences encoded by these polynucleotides. This patent also includes vectors, hosts comprising the polynucleotides, assays, and various other applications. Additionally, this invention offers polynucleotide and polypeptide sequence information stored on computer-readable media, enabling the development of computer-based systems and methods to facilitate their use. Career Highlights
Michael R. Fannon's career has been marked by his role at Human Genome Sciences, Inc., a leading company in the field of genomic research. His work at this organization underscores his dedication to advancing the science of genetics and contributing to innovative solutions in healthcare and biotechnology.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Fannon has had the opportunity to collaborate with esteemed colleagues such as Charles A. Kunsch and Steven C. Barash. These partnerships have not only enriched his work but have also facilitated groundbreaking advancements in the genomics sector.
